Overview

This timely handbook represents the latest thinking in the field of technology and innovation management, with an up-to-date overview of the key developments in the field.

  • The editor provides with a critical, introductory essay that establishes the theoretical framework for studying technology and innovation management
  • The book will include 15-20 original essays by leading authors chosen for their key contribution to the field
  • These chapters chart the important debates and theoretical issues under 3 or 4 thematic headings
  • The handbook concludes with an essay by the Editor highlighting the emergent issues for research
  • The book is targeted as a handbook for academics as well as a text for graduate courses in technology and innovation management

Table of Contents

Preface ix

List of Contributors xi

Editor’s Introduction xv

Part I The Evolution of Technology, Markets, and Industry 1

1 Technology and Industry Evolution 3
Rajshree Agarwal and Mary Tripsas

2 The Evolution of Markets: Innovation Adoption, Diffusion, Market Growth, New Product Entry, and Competitor Responses 57
Venkatesh Shankar

Part II The Development and Introduction of New Products 113

3 Understanding Customer Needs 115
Barry L. Bayus

4 Product Development as a Problem-solving Process 143
Christian Terwiesch

5 Managing the ‘Unmanageables’ of Sustained Product Innovation 173
Deborah Dougherty

Part III The Management and Organization of Innovation 195

6 Rival Interpretations of Balancing Exploration and Exploitation: Simultaneous or Sequential? 197
Eric L. Chen and Riitta Katila

7 R&D Project Selection and Portfolio Management: A Review of the Past, a Description of the Present, and a Sketch of the Future 215
D. Brunner, L. Fleming, A. MacCormack, and D. Zinner

8 Managing the Innovative Performance of Technical Professionals 239
Ralph Katz

Part IV Technology Strategy 265

9 The Economics and Strategy of Standards and Standardization 267
Shane Greenstein and Victor Stango

10 Intellectual Property and Innovation 295
Rosemarie H. Ziedonis

11 Orchestrating Appropriability: Towards an Endogenous View of Capturing Value from Innovation Investments 335
Henry Chesbrough

12 Individual Collaborations, Strategic Alliances and Innovation: Insights from the Biotechnology Industry 353
Paul Almeida, Jan Hohberger, and Pedro Parada

Part V Who Innovates? 365

13 Technology-Based Entrepreneurship 367
David H. Hsu

14 Knowledge Spillover Entrepreneurship and Innovation in Large and Small Firms 389
David B. Audretsch

15 The Financing of Innovation 409
Bronwyn H. Hall

16 The Contribution of Public Entities to Innovation and Technological Change 431
Maryann P. Feldman and Dieter F. Kogler

Index 461
